Ok it is very easy to do. First slide back your arm rest. While sitting in the drivers seat look at the front right side of the cup holder area. If you look closely you will see a small plastic piece. Take a small flat head screw driver and gently pop it out. After the cover piece is removed if you look inside you will see a 10mm nut i believe. You will need a ratchet and deep socket and small extension to tighten your parking brake to where you want it.

PARKING BRAKE LEVER ADJUSTMENT

DIY: Parking brake adjustment-112005999.gif

1.Depress the brake pedal several times.
2.Remove the service hole cover of the rear console.
3.Turn the adjusting nut and adjust the parking brake lever.
4.After adjustment, pull the parking brake lever one notch and verify that the parking brake warning light illuminates.
5.Verify that the rear brakes do not drag.

Just in case this gets searched again though, its actually a 10mm nut that needs to be tightened. Make sure you have a deep socket, and make sure the parking brake isn't engaged. " as in, it is down."

It took me a few minutes to realize that the tightening nut was attached to the handle, so if it was engaged, its at a really odd angle, where you can't really get at it.
